Choosing the right one for your home requires careful analysis to narrow down upholstery options and find the most suitable frame and suspension system.

Cushions and upholstery fabric are re-usable, but a good couch must have a sturdy inner frame to support it. The cheaper models typically include a particleboard or plastic frame, while quality couches use kiln-dried hardwoods like oak, beech, or Ash. The wood should be interlocked using mortise and dovetail as well as other interlocking options. Examine the frame of the couch to see if it is solid and stable or if it's shaky. This could indicate a poor design.

The kind of fabric you choose will depend on how the couch will be used. For instance, if you plan to entertain guests, you may need more durable fabric that will endure spills and stains. If you have children or pets, a durable, easy-to-clean fabric is essential. A tightly woven material is more resistant to sagging than loosely upholstered fabrics. A rub count of between 50,000 and 150,000 is typical for durable fabrics.

If you're looking for a sturdy couch that will last for a long time and is affordable then look at Article. The furniture retailer online is exclusively in mid-century design with a Scandinavian style. The site is simple to navigate with filters like "Ready to Ship", "Returnable" and "Multi-configurations".

Another excellent option is Sixpenny, which carries elegant, casually chic couches that are as comfortable as they are sophisticated. The majority of its couches are made to order and customers can pick from a variety of upholstery options, including cotton linen, cotton velvet and recycled faux fur. Customers can choose between feather down or a synthetic vegan option for cushion fill.

Joybird is a great option to purchase a couch. They make customizable pieces that can be adapted to your lifestyle and space. The company's sofas, which are made to last, are available in various sizes and fabrics. Joybird provides free samples of fabric and colors for those who are having difficulty choosing.

CB2 is a different furniture store with couches that are designed with contemporary silhouettes and modern materials. CB2 offers a range of colors and upholstery materials including light grey to black. It also supports the local economy and its Chicago and Los Angeles stores feature a rotating list of local artists and designers. Plus, customers can return items within 30 days for a 10% fee.
